Flow cytometric comparison of different clones for CD158f (KIR2DL5). Human peripheral blood mononuclear cells (PBMCs) were stained with CD158f (KIR2DL5) antibodies and with a suitable counterstaining. As a control, CD158f (KIR2DL5) antibody staining was omitted and cells were measured in the same channels. Flow cytometry was performed with the MACSQuant® Analyzer. Cell debris, dead cells, and cell doublets were excluded from the analysis based on scatter signals and 4',6-diamidino-2-phenylindole (DAPI) fluorescence. No FcR Blocking Reagent was used. The recommended titers of respective antibodies from different suppliers were used.

Specifications for CD158f (KIR2DL5) Antibody, anti-human

Overview

Clone UP-R1 recognizes CD158f (KIR2DL5), a member of the killer immunoglobulin-like receptor (KIR) family which recognizes subsets of HLA alleles. Expression is found mainly on CD56
dim
CD16
+
natural killer (NK) cells but also on a subset of CD8
+
T cells. KIRs are monomeric receptors possessing high allelic polymorphism, with either two or three Ig-like extracellular domains.
